NDUFB11 ELISA kits are immunoassay tools for the measurement of the protein NADH:ubiquinone oxidoreductase subunit B11, which is encoded by the NDUFB11 gene in humans. Functionally, this protein is reported to be an accessory subunit the mitochondrial membrane respiratory chain NADH dehydrogenase (Complex I), that is believed not to be involved in catalysis. The canonical protein structure is reported to have an amino acid length of 153 residues, a mass of 17.3 kDa, and is a member of the Complex I NDUFB11 subunit protein family. It is known to be localized in the mitochondria and is ubiquitously expressed across many tissue types. As many as 2 protein isoforms have been reported. The NDUFB11 gene has been associated with the disease, Linear skin defects with multiple congenital anomalies. Other alias names for this target include ESSS, MC1DN30, NP17.3, Np15, P17.3, and CI-ESSS.
